Physical Differences Between Squid and Cuttlefish
When you look at squid and cuttlefish, their bodies might seem similar due to their elongated shapes, but they have some striking physical differences. One of the first things you’ll notice is the body structure. Squid have a more streamlined body, which helps them swim quickly through the water. They’ve got fins that run along the sides, which they use like rudders. Cuttlefish, on the other hand, have a broader, more flattened body with fins that encircle their bodies. Imagine comparing a sleek sports car to a sturdy SUV—the shapes highlight their different capabilities.
Another key physical feature is their internal structures. Cuttlefish have a unique internal shell called a cuttlebone, which helps them regulate buoyancy. This structure is often found washed up on beaches, and it’s pretty light and porous. Squid lack a cuttlebone; instead, they have a hard external structure called a pen. It’s a bit like comparing a paperclip to a notebook—both are useful, but they serve different purposes.
Finally, let’s talk about color and skin texture. Both squid and cuttlefish are known for their incredible ability to change color and texture thanks to special cells called chromatophores. However, cuttlefish are particularly talented at camouflage. They can match their surroundings in a blink, almost like nature’s very own mood rings. Squid can also change color, but they tend to be more vibrant and bold, flaunting their colors to attract mates or warn predators.
Habitat and Distribution
Squid and cuttlefish might live in the same ocean waters, but they do have different habitat preferences. Squid are often found in open oceans, where they can swim freely and hunt for smaller fish and crustaceans. They like to roam in deeper waters, sometimes diving down to great depths. Think of them as the adventurers of the ocean, always on the move.
In contrast, cuttlefish typically prefer coastal waters and shallow bays. They’re often found in areas with plenty of hiding spots like reefs or seaweed beds. This is where their amazing camouflage skills come into play. They can blend into their environment while waiting to ambush prey, making them masterful hunters. Imagine you’re in a crowded coffee shop: squid would be the ones zooming around, while cuttlefish would be the ones sitting quietly in the corner, carefully observing their surroundings.
Both species are found in various parts of the world, from tropical to temperate seas. However, their preferences for habitat mean that you might encounter them in different settings while exploring the ocean. If you’re snorkeling or diving, you might spot a squid darting away from you, while a cuttlefish may be hiding behind a rock, waiting for the perfect moment to catch its next meal.
Feeding Habits: What Do They Eat?
When it comes to their diets, both squid and cuttlefish are carnivorous, but they have slightly different feeding strategies. Squid are often aggressive hunters, preying on fish and crustaceans. They use their speed and agility to chase down their meals, striking with their tentacles to grab their catch. This fast-paced hunting style is what you’d expect from a creature that’s designed for speed.
Cuttlefish, on the other hand, have a more calculated approach. They tend to ambush their prey rather than chase it down. Using their incredible ability to camouflage, they can blend into their surroundings and wait patiently for unsuspecting fish or shrimp to swim by. Once the moment is right, they pounce with lightning speed. It’s like watching a suspenseful game of hide-and-seek, where the cuttlefish is the master at being both hidden and suddenly visible!
Both creatures also have a unique way of capturing food—thanks to their long tentacles and powerful beaks. These adaptations allow them to pierce through shells and grasp slippery prey, ensuring that they get their fair share of food, whether they’re chasing or ambushing.
Reproductive Strategies
The way squid and cuttlefish reproduce also highlights their differences. Squid often engage in elaborate courtship displays to attract mates. Males may change colors and perform intricate dances to impress the females. Once a female chooses her mate, she will lay thousands of eggs in clusters. This strategy is designed to ensure that at least some of the young survive predators.
Cuttlefish have a slightly different approach. They also use color displays, but they often employ a more subtle tactic. Males may display vibrant colors to attract females but can quickly change their appearance to blend in if they sense competition from other males. After mating, females lay fewer eggs, often hiding them in safe spots among rocks or coral. This cautious strategy reflects their preference for safety and stealth.
Both squid and cuttlefish have intriguing reproductive strategies, showcasing the diversity of life in the ocean. It’s fascinating to consider how their different approaches influence the survival of their species.
Behavioral Differences in the Wild
Behaviorally, squid and cuttlefish exhibit traits that align with their physical adaptations. Squid are generally more social, often seen in large schools. They communicate with each other using color changes and body movements, which can create stunning visual displays in the water. Watching a school of squid swim together is like observing a synchronized dance; their movements are fluid and mesmerizing.
Cuttlefish, on the other hand, are more solitary and territorial. They prefer to stay hidden, employing their camouflage to avoid detection. Their behavior is more about patience and stealth rather than speed and social interaction. Picture a cuttlefish as a stealthy ninja, quietly observing and waiting for the right moment to strike.
This difference in behavior doesn’t just affect how they interact with each other but also how they respond to threats. Squid may choose to flee when faced with danger, darting away at high speeds, while cuttlefish will often rely on their ability to blend into their environment, avoiding confrontation altogether.
The Importance of Squid and Cuttlefish
Both squid and cuttlefish play significant roles in their ecosystems. As predators, they help maintain the balance of marine life by controlling populations of smaller fish and crustaceans. Without them, there could be overpopulation in certain areas, leading to ecosystem imbalances.
Moreover, both species are essential to the diets of larger marine animals, including dolphins, seals, and larger fish. This makes them crucial not just in their immediate habitats but also in the broader ocean food web. By understanding their roles, we can appreciate the importance of conserving these fascinating creatures.
Additionally, squid and cuttlefish are often subjects of scientific study, helping researchers understand evolution, behavior, and even potential applications for technology inspired by their unique biology. Their ability to change color and texture has sparked interest in developing new materials and technologies that mimic these natural abilities.
